A DAY OF IRE ᚨ ᛞᚨᚤ ᛟᚠ ᛁᚱᛖ This stone month, our people have had their fill of festivities, with weddings occurring every other week and new dwarves arriving from the treacherous mountains, reuniting with their kin. Our people thrive and our Kingdom flourishes with peace around the realm. To celebrate such an occasion, The Grand Kingdom announces two great events to take place in the coming weeks. A GRAND WEDDING ᚨ ᚷᚱᚨᚾᛞ ᚹᛖᛞᛞᛁᚾᚷ The Grand King announces with great pride, a ceremony of the ages to officialize two dwarves in marriage before the Gods. Grand King, Bakir Ireheart shall be married to Ealisaid of Clan Mossborn, and officially be crowned as the Queen of Urguan. With such an occasion, the finest mead shall be brewed with the look of gold to present to the guests of this great feast. A GRAND TOURNAMENT ᛏᚺᛖ ᚷᚱᚨᚾᛞ ᚲᚺᚨᛗᛈᛁᛟᚾ ᛏᛟᚢᚱᚾᚨᛗᛖᚾᛏ To honor the newly crowned Grand Queen of Urguan, and the guests from around the realm. A royal tournament shall take place for all guests to enjoy. To heighten the stakes, a prize of 1,500 Mina shall be given to the winner of the tournament. The Grand Kingdom formally invites its closest allies, friends, and kin, to each ceremony to celebrate and feast amongst the halls of Kal’Darakaan. The following Kingdoms and peoples are invited. The Kingdom of Haense The Kingdom of Balian The Kingdom of Malinor The Principality of Sedan The State of Lurin The citizens of Khron’Hundmar Event Date 10/30/2022, At 4 pm EST.
  2. [!] The Horn of the Deep bellows out and echo throughout the caverns of Kal’Darakaan as the dwarven people flood the streets from the Hall of the Obsidian Throne. A great ruckus and celebration erupts as the winds of history shift once more... THE ASCENSION OF BAKIR IREHEART For many decades has Grand King Ulfric Frostbeard reigned prosperously, continuing the progress made by his predecessors and leading Urguan through a tumultuous war; but any Longbeard who has worn the weight of the Grand Crown, who has felt the piercing edges of the Obsidian Throne know that it is a great burden. And no matter how well a reign, after a certain time it weathers down the mighty stone of a King’s fortitude, and he must come to resign. Grand King Ulfric Frostbeard began to feel the weight of his crown, the pain of his throne, and knew that for Urguan to prosper and grow to new heights, it would need a new king. It is such wisdom that brought Ulfric to abdicate. It was on the eve of the 3rd of the Deep Cold, SA 67, where Ulfric Frostbeard held a council meeting, at which he raised the crown off his head and set it on the throne, announcing his resignation. There was a final cheer for Grand King Ulfric ‘the Uniter’ Frostbeard, before it would continue to pass towards the nominations of the next Grand King. Much like his kin Utak Ireheart in the old Under-Realm, Bakir Ireheart was unanimously nominated and elected to the office of Grand King, leader of all dwarfdom. A great cry bellowed from the council room, and the mountain shook with the cheering of a rejuvenated dwarven people. Bakir Ireheart has been officially elected the 34th Grand King of Urguan, and shall be crowned by the High Prophet Norli Starbreaker on the 8th of Sun's Smile, SA 68 (Sunday, 3/20 at 4 PM EST), in the Hall of the Obsidian Throne. All of the children of the Brathmordakin are summoned to appear in the court, as well as all allies and friends of the Grand Kingdom of Urguan invited to participate in the festivities thereafter. The Abdication of a Brewer [!] Within the Grand King’s Palace of Urguan’s capital city, Kal’Darakaan, whose stone hewn walls are carved into the mountain itself, Levian’Tol sits at an oaken table before a hearth. Like many of his brethren, a pipe rests between his lips while his dark gaze traverses the paper before him. Each word is inked carefully, each sentence finished without flourish. It was not every day that a King informs his kin of a voluntary change in regime. Denizens of Urguan and my kin, Though I was elected Grand King nae even an age ago, I am content with what I have done. I now realize I face a path that every monarch before I has had to tread - that of forcing one’s reign to continue or stepping down and allowing another to serve our Nation. Our past kings have chosen the former. They have refused to reject power that is not their own and our people have suffered for it. Yet, I seek to chase a different future. In my time, I have served Urguan with faith and loyalty from atop the Obsidian Throne. I have led the legion, brought renewed wealth and prosperity not just to the halls of Kal’Darakaan, but to all the lands of the Grand Kingdom. Urguan has grown strong with my incorporation of The Unified Domain of Vortice and the collapse of Krugmar into the Iron’Uzg fueled by dwedmar blades. The vast auxiliaries of our borders now stand to supplement the dwedmar legion each time we go into battle. The Crimson Edict, with their age-old grudge against slavery defeated for the foreseeable future, assist the Lord Justicar in discovering and stemming any outbreak of corruption against our nation. The Order of the Golden Lion stands ready in their Keep of Sunbreak to lash out against any incursion, be it from the void or otherwise. South Sedan, Vasoyevi, Stygian Hollow, Lubba’s Keep, and Myrine all stand proudly with the Grand Kingdom. Our enemies are theirs, and theirs ours. The Mages Guild has returned once more and the Remembrancer Library stands finally completed with scholars from all the lands of Almaris eager to study inside its tall walls. In the days of old, eons ago, we Dwedmar once had an Empire. I return to you now, my people, the closest we have come to that legacy in many stone years. I hope only that my successor has the intelligence to build on what I have done, rather than letting it regress to isolationism. Let Urguan swell with the riches I have gathered and flourish with the denizens I have brought in. To my kin, my dwedmar, the future of Urguan rests now in your hands. May the Brathmordakin guide your paths as they have guided mine. ~ Grand King, Levian’Tol Grandaxe [!] The Grand King would deliver a short hand version of this letter before his council before removing the Crown of Urguan, given to him from hands of Grand Emperor Rhewen Frostbeard himself, from his head and placing it infront of his Lord Justicar, Ulfric Frostbeard, as he left the Obsidian Throne for the last time to the sounds of his kins cheers. As issued 10th of The Sun's Smile, 4 2A MILITARY FINANCIAL ALLOCATION ACT It is the sovereign duty of the Grand Council to guarantee that the Legion of Urguan is not only active but properly equipped. In the past, this duty has been left to the oversight of the Grand Merchant and the Grand King, however, those charged with the upkeep of the Legion have neglected their duties, placing the burden upon the Grand Marshal and his officers. This dereliction of responsibility was successful in the past only because of the abundance of wealth that the Grand Kingdom enjoyed. Yet in recent times, a lack of funds has been felt throughout the continent, leaving the Legion struggling to acquire sufficient capital to support its infrastructure. Thus, we now find it necessary to form a proper budget for the Legion, allowing the Grand Marshal and his officers the appropriate funds required to fulfill their obligations both to protect the Kingdom during times of peace and to ready the military for any future conflicts. SECTION I - THE LEGION BUDGET The pay scale for the Legion may only be adjusted through the Grand Council of Urguan, although the Grand Marshal may pay bonuses to legionnaires directly from the Legion Reserve. The payment of each member is based on their rank, and the pay will be as follows: Grand Marshal: N/A Commander: N/A Legate: 24 Minae Pridebearer: 20 Minae Longbeard: 16 Minae Ironbreaker: 12 Minae Stoneguard: 8 Minae Grunt: 4 Minae Based on the pay scales outlined, the Legion of Urguan shall receive funds from the Treasury of the Grand Kingdom. The number of funds allotted to the Legion will be revised on a biennial (every two years) basis, to account for any growth in the legion. The redefining of the Budget is to be a collective effort between the Grand Merchant and the Grand Marshal. SECTION II - THE LEGION RESERVE It has always been the nature of the Legion that those who work, receive compensation, and those who do not work will not receive compensation. As a result, there may be an excess of funds at the end of some years. Thus we propose a Legion Reserve, governed by the following regulations: The Legion Reserve is to be controlled directly by the Grand Marshal and is to be dispensed at his discretion, so long as it is to benefit the Legion. Examples of Proper dispensation of funds include, but are not limited to: The payment of new legionnaires. The acquisition of arms and armor. The payment of bonuses to legionnaires that excel in their service. The payment of Legion sponsored events. The payment required to maintain the Legion of Urguan Mission System. This reserve is limited to a maximum of 2,000 minae but it may be raised through the will of the Grand Council. Any surplus mina will be remitted directly to the Kingdom. Donations made directly to the Legion will also go directly into this reserve and thus be under the purview of the minae limit. SECTION III - STATUTES & REVISALS This bill reaffirms the Grand King’s innate sole authority over the Legion. The Grand King may at choice reject the spending of the Legion Reserve. Furthermore, in order to check the powers granted to the Grand Marshal and the Legion by this document. The Grand King, as well as the Grand Merchant, will be granted the power to audit The Legion Budget and Legion Reserve at any time. Upon their request, the Grand Marshal will be required to provide detailed financial documents that show when and how the Legion’s Funds are being utilized. If some discrepancy is found in these documents, the Grand Marshal will be held legally accountable and will be investigated for fraud. Furthermore, if implemented, any section of this proposal is subject to change through a simple majority vote of the Grand Council.
